   Digital Foundations
Advanced Broadband
 
Newfoundland & Labrador : Broadband is a challenge for large rural sparsely populated areas
 
Donegal : Actively working to ensure that Donegal's businesses and citizens are connected at work and at home with fibre, public wi-fi and the latest mobile technologies.
 
Gaeltacht : Cooperate with Ireland's national broadband plan to prioritise and maximise the rollout of high speed broadband in Gaeltacht areas listed in the plan.
Digital Skills
 
Donegal : Establish a working group on training spearheaded by ATU Letterkenny and pursue set-up of a Donegal Training portal related to digital skills.
 
Gaeltacht : Flagship language learning project based on close links with TG4 resources + virtual reality platform aimed at all Gaeltacht population + distinct communities in that. This could be conceived with Basque, Finnish & Slovenian language interests
Digital Research
 
Donegal : Work with universities in West, North West and Northern Ireland to increase the supply of the relevant digital research needed to support smart specialisation and target economic sectors
 
Gaeltacht : Initiative to influence the digital research priorities being conducted in NUIG and the Institutes of Technology on the West coast (Tralee, Limerick, GMIT, Sligo, Letterkenny) to ensure it meets priorities in Gaeltacht targeted S3.

   Digital Innovation
Open Data
Open Innovation Test Beds
 
Donegal : Develop "living labs" in the key areas of Advanced Manufacturing, Public Services (Energy, Public Planning service) Blue Ocean and Tourism and Culture (VR). Leverage the Digital Hubs network (Blue Economy in Killybegs; VR in Gaoth Dobhair,....

Digital Innovation Hubs
 
Donegal : Deliver a network of digital innovation hubs to support local communities, SME's, start-ups, remote workers. Pursue collaboration between Donegal Hubs. Develop advanced tech exposure & digital capacity of SME's & communities via the Hubs.

Remote Working
 
Donegal : Implement the actions in Donegal's Remote Working Strategy to increase the number of digital remote workers, entrepreneurs, startups and existing tech companies with a presence in the County.
